Shopfloor and Structural Sheet Steel Welding

From thin, hollow structural sections to tractors and trucks, sheet steel makes up many of the items we rely on every day.  Structural sheet steel is also used in critical applications such as pharmaceutical processing equipment and high-performance marine and aerospace assemblies.

To facilitate safe and reliable sheet metal welding, Shopfloor includes welding forms and Code checks that comply with the AWS D1.3 Structural Welding Code for Sheet Steel.

AWS D1.3 Structural Welding Code Sheet Steel in Shopfloor

The AWS D1.1 Structural Steel Welding Code

This sheet steel welding functionality mirrors the AWS D1.1 structural steel welding code feature already available in Shopfloor.  Note that support for creating prequalified AWS welding procedures is also provided by Shopfloor.   Prequalified welding procedures are exempt from testing requirements and can reduce welding costs by thousands of dollars.

Switching between Welding Codes in Shopfloor is accomplished by simply selecting the desired Welding Code from the Codes menu.
